Important Terms in Credit Repair

Familiarity with key terms can empower you to better understand your credit repair journey. Below are some commonly used concepts and their definitions to assist you.

Credit Report

A credit report is a detailed record of an individual’s credit history, including loans, credit cards, payment history, and outstanding debts. It is used by lenders to assess creditworthiness.

Dispute

A dispute is a formal challenge to information on a credit report that is believed to be inaccurate, incomplete, or unverifiable. Disputes are submitted to credit bureaus for investigation.

Credit Score

A credit score is a numerical representation of an individual’s creditworthiness, calculated based on credit report information. Scores influence loan approvals and interest rates.

Debt Settlement

Debt settlement involves negotiating with creditors to reduce the total amount owed, often as a lump-sum payment, to resolve outstanding debts.

Helpful Tips for Effective Credit Repair

Review Your Credit Reports Regularly

Regularly checking your credit reports from all major bureaus helps you stay informed about your credit status and quickly identify any inaccuracies or changes that require attention.

Keep Detailed Records of Communications

Maintaining thorough records of all correspondence with creditors and credit bureaus can support your disputes and provide evidence if issues arise during the credit repair process.

Understand Your Rights Under the Law

Being informed about your rights under the Fair Credit Reporting Act and other regulations empowers you to take appropriate action and ensures that your credit repair efforts are legally supported.

Frequently Asked Questions About Credit Repair

What is the first step in the credit repair process?

The first step in credit repair is a thorough review of your credit reports from all major credit bureaus. This allows for identification of inaccuracies or negative items that may be impacting your credit score. Once these are identified, formal disputes can be submitted to correct or remove these items. This process lays the foundation for improving your credit profile over time.

Credit repair duration varies depending on the complexity of your credit issues and the responsiveness of credit bureaus and creditors. Typically, initial results may be seen within a few months, but comprehensive repair can take longer. Patience and consistent follow-up are important throughout the process to achieve the best outcomes.

Not all negative items can be removed from your credit report, especially if they are accurate and verifiable. However, inaccuracies, outdated information, and unverifiable entries can often be disputed and removed. Legal assistance helps ensure that disputes are properly submitted and that your rights are protected during this process.

Credit repair is legal in Arizona and governed by federal and state laws that protect consumers. These laws ensure that credit reporting is fair and accurate, and they provide mechanisms for disputing incorrect information. Working with legal professionals helps ensure compliance with these regulations and safeguards your interests.
